I just got my LRD full exhaust system. In the past LRD got us spot on with the jetting of our LRD pipes on our 250R, but I figure I'll also ask the people here. I hear some of you are running approximately 160 mains with exhaust and minor intake mods, and then a buddy of mine is running a 170 with a WB E-series full exhaust, UNI filter, and no airbox cover. I'm going to also be running a UNI with no airbox cover, but for some reason the 170 sounds a bit overkill. Do any of you have the LRD system, or a very similar flowing system(no spark arrestor), and have excellent results with certain jetting? Any help is much appreciated. Did you change spark plug heat ranges? Pilot sizes? Needle shapes or heights? How does it run in summer and then in winter with the same jetting? Thanks alot...

White Bro's pro-meg system, airbox on, k&n filter, 158 keihen main, 45 keihen pilot, stock needle up one, 1200 feet elevation.

Starts in zero degree temps with no choke or fuel!

On my 400EX before the motor build I had a Big Gun full system, K&N, no air box, etc. The bast power was on Dyno Jet needle 3rd clip, 155 main. Then I bought a TC 425 motor with high comp piston, track cam, ported. He set the jetting at 160 main 3rd clip. He said leave the the 38 pilot jet in and run it 3.5 turns out. Too many guys over jet bikes more fuel doesn't make more power... The proper air to fuel ratio makes more power.
